Scotland's National Record of the Historic Environment records Glasgow, Park Gardens, Steps as Steps (mid 19th Century) (1853)-(1854). The official map says its point is accurate as follows: NGR given to the nearest 1m. The record does not by itself mean that the public may enter the place.
The historic-place record does not grant public access. Check current conditions and ownership before entering land or a building.
